git commit 如何保存退出

fiy 其他 491

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要保存并退出 Git commit ,需要按照以下步骤进行操作:

    1. 首先,在执行 `git commit` 命令后,Git 会自动打开一个文本编辑器来编辑提交信息。

    2. 在文本编辑器中,输入提交的相关信息,包括该次提交的目的、所做的更改等。

    3. 按住 `Ctrl` 键并同时按下 `X` 键,然后按 `Y` 键来保存修改。

    4. 按下 `Enter` 键,即可保存修改并退出文本编辑器。

    5. Git commit 在退出文本编辑器后会自动完成提交操作,并显示相关的提交结果信息。

    在 Git 中,还有一种快捷方式可直接在命令行中输入提交信息,而不是打开文本编辑器编辑。可以使用以下语法:

    “`
    git commit -m “提交信息”
    “`

    其中,双引号中的内容是提交信息的内容。请注意,使用这种快捷方式,提交信息通常不会太长,应尽量简洁明了。快捷方式适用于一些小型或者临时性的提交。

    总结起来,要保存并退出 Git commit ,你可以通过文本编辑器进行提交信息的编辑和保存,或者使用快捷方式在命令行中直接输入提交信息。在完成了提交信息的编辑和保存后,Git 会自动完成提交操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在使用Git进行代码版本管理时,可以使用`git commit`命令来保存代码的修改,并生成一个新的提交记录。默认情况下,`git commit`命令会打开一个文本编辑器,要求你输入提交信息,然后你需要保存退出。以下是一些方式来保存退出`git commit`命令:

    1. 简短描述模式:你可以使用`-m`选项来在命令行中一次性输入提交信息,而不需要打开编辑器。例如:
    “`
    git commit -m “Update README file”
    “`
    这样,你就可以在命令行中直接输入提交信息,而无需打开编辑器。

    2. 默认编辑器模式:如果你没有使用`-m`选项,并且没有设置`git configuration`中的默认编辑器,那么`git commit`命令将使用系统默认的文本编辑器来打开一个临时文件,你需要在其中输入提交信息。

    – 在大多数Linux系统上,默认编辑器是Vi或Vim。要保存退出,你需要先按下`Esc`键,然后输入`:wq`命令并按下`Enter`键,这将保存你的修改并退出Vi/Vim编辑器。

    – 在macOS系统上,默认编辑器是Vi或者Vim,你可以按照上述的方法进行保存退出。

    – 在Windows系统上,默认编辑器是Notepad。在Notepad中,你可以按下`Ctrl + S`键来保存修改,然后按下`Alt + F4`键或关闭窗口来退出Notepad。

    3. 自定义编辑器模式:如果你想自定义使用的编辑器,可以在`git configuration`中设置。例如,如果你想使用Visual Studio Code作为编辑器,可以运行以下命令:
    “`
    git config –global core.editor “code –wait”
    “`
    这样,当你运行`git commit`命令时,Visual Studio Code将作为编辑器打开,并等待你保存并退出。

    总结一下,无论是使用简短描述模式、默认编辑器模式还是自定义编辑器模式,你都可以通过保存修改并退出编辑器来完成`git commit`命令的操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Git commit 并不是一个可以保存退出的操作,而是一个用于将修改内容提交到本地仓库的命令。当执行 git commit 后,会打开一个编辑器,供你输入提交信息。提交信息通常包括一个标题和一个详细描述。

    以下是在 Git 中进行 commit 的方法和操作流程:

    1. 确保已经在 Git 项目目录中,使用 `git status` 命令可以查看当前文件的修改状态。

    2. 如果有新的文件或修改,使用 `git add <文件名>` 命令将文件添加到暂存区。可以使用 `git add .` 或 `git add -A` 将所有文件添加到暂存区。

    3. 使用 `git commit` 命令提交修改。这样会打开一个编辑器,供你输入提交信息。

    4. 在编辑器中,添加一个简短的标题,概括这次提交的内容。然后,插入一个空行,并在下面写下详细描述。

    5. 保存并关闭编辑器。保存提交信息后,Git 会将修改内容和提交信息保存到本地仓库中。

    需要注意的是,Git commit 是一个必需的操作,不可避免地需要输入提交信息。提交信息有助于记录和跟踪代码的变更历史,以便日后追溯和分析。

    当然,也可以直接使用命令行操作,将提交信息作为参数传递给 `git commit` 命令,如 `git commit -m “这里是提交标题” -m “这里是详细描述”`。

    综上所述,git commit 操作不能保存退出,但可以通过提交信息来记录对代码的修改。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部